Why Travelers Insurance is Essential

Travel is often accompanied by unexpected events, such as trip cancellations, medical emergencies, or lost luggage. Travelers insurance serves as a safety net, providing financial protection and ensuring that you can focus on your journey rather than potential mishaps. Whether you are heading to a tropical paradise or a bustling city, understanding the importance of travelers insurance is crucial.

Financial Security Against Trip Disruptions

One of the primary reasons travelers opt for insurance is to safeguard their financial investments. Imagine booking a dream vacation, only to have to cancel due to unforeseen circumstances such as illness or a family emergency. Without travelers insurance, you may lose the entire cost of your trip. Insurance can help recover non-refundable expenses, ensuring that your financial loss is minimized.

Medical Emergencies and Assistance

Traveling abroad can expose you to different health risks. While your domestic health insurance may cover you at home, it often falls short overseas. Travelers insurance typically includes emergency medical coverage, which can cover hospital stays, surgeries, and even medical evacuation if necessary. This coverage provides peace of mind, knowing that help is readily available should you need it.

Types of Travelers Insurance

Understanding the different types of travelers insurance available will help you choose the right policy for your needs. Here, we break down the main types:

1. Trip Cancellation Insurance

This type of insurance protects your investment by reimbursing you for non-refundable travel costs if you need to cancel your trip due to covered reasons such as illness, injury, or other emergencies. Knowing that your financial commitment is secured allows you to plan your travel with confidence.

2. Medical Coverage

Medical coverage is critical for travelers, especially those venturing into remote areas. This insurance pays for medical expenses incurred while traveling, including doctor visits, hospital stays, and even emergency transportation. It’s particularly vital for international travel, where healthcare systems can be significantly different from your own.

3. Baggage Insurance

Lost, stolen, or damaged luggage can dampen any trip. Baggage insurance helps you recover the costs associated with lost belongings, providing reimbursement for essential items and personal property. This coverage ensures that even if your luggage goes missing, your travel experience remains enjoyable.

4. Travel Delay Insurance

Travel delays can occur for various reasons, such as weather disruptions or mechanical issues. Travel delay insurance compensates you for additional expenses incurred during delays, including accommodations and meals. This coverage ensures that you are not left in a bind while waiting for your journey to resume.

5. Emergency Evacuation Insurance

In the event of a serious medical situation, emergency evacuation insurance covers the costs of transporting you to a medical facility or back home. This insurance is particularly important for travelers visiting remote areas or countries with limited medical resources.

Choosing the Right Policy

Selecting the appropriate travelers insurance can be overwhelming, given the multitude of options available. Here are essential factors to consider when making your choice:

1. Assess Your Needs

Evaluate the specifics of your trip. Consider factors such as your destination, the duration of your stay, and activities planned. If you are engaging in adventurous activities like skiing or scuba diving, look for policies that offer coverage for those specific risks.

2. Compare Policies

Don’t settle for the first policy you encounter. Take the time to compare multiple insurance providers. Look for key features such as coverage limits, deductibles, and exclusions. Comprehensive policies often provide better protection, so ensure you understand what is included and what is not.

3. Read Reviews

Customer reviews can offer valuable insights into the claims process and overall satisfaction. Look for policies with positive feedback regarding customer service and ease of filing claims, as these factors can significantly impact your experience in times of need.

4. Understand Exclusions

All insurance policies come with exclusions. Read the fine print carefully to understand what is not covered. Common exclusions may include pre-existing medical conditions or specific activities deemed high risk. Awareness of these exclusions will help you avoid surprises when filing a claim.

The Benefits of Travelers Insurance

Investing in travelers insurance is not merely about protecting yourself from financial loss; it also offers several additional benefits:

1. Peace of Mind

Knowing you are covered allows you to enjoy your trip without the constant worry of what might go wrong. This peace of mind enhances your overall travel experience, allowing you to immerse yourself in new cultures and adventures.

2. Assistance Services

Many insurance providers offer 24/7 assistance services to policyholders. This service can be invaluable in emergencies, providing guidance on medical facilities, legal help, or even lost passport support. Having a reliable point of contact can ease stress in difficult situations.
